Transaction 121a82ba57ad7203200b203f64b47ee21d5362f36148519a011dea0b486dc284

2 Input
2 Outputs
  • 121a82ba57ad7203200b203f64b47ee21d5362f36148519a011dea0b486dc284:0
  • value  1318747
    address  1BKeAYDMX9cxtTDzytmLsd9NYnhr1b5ZDH
  • 121a82ba57ad7203200b203f64b47ee21d5362f36148519a011dea0b486dc284:1
  • value  50141
    address  1P4F81rJfaYQf4fGtPFY8UEXPzQEDTGyZa